Key Ingredients and Their Benefits
This product’s effectiveness stems from a carefully selected blend of natural ingredients.
- Botanical Extracts: Infusions of various plant extracts, such as aloe vera juice, add moisture and shine to the hair. Aloe vera, in particular, is known for its soothing properties and ability to promote hair health.
- Agave Nectar Extract: Agave nectar, a natural humectant, helps to attract and retain moisture, crucial for keeping curls hydrated and preventing dryness. This ingredient also provides a subtle hold and definition.
- Marshmallow Root Extract: This extract is a natural detangler and conditioner. It adds slip to the hair, making it easier to manage and reducing breakage. Marshmallow root also helps to define curls and add volume.
- Other Ingredients: The formula typically includes ingredients like vitamin E, which acts as an antioxidant, protecting the hair from environmental damage. Citric acid is often included to balance the pH level of the product.
These ingredients work synergistically to create a product that not only defines curls but also nourishes and protects the hair.

Ideal Curl Patterns for Optimal Results
The Kinky Curly Curling Custard is particularly well-suited for specific curl patterns. The product’s formulation focuses on enhancing natural curl definition, providing hold, and minimizing frizz.
- Type 3 Hair (Curly): This includes hair ranging from loose, well-defined “S” patterns to tighter corkscrew curls. The custard excels at defining and holding these curls, offering a lightweight hold that doesn’t weigh the hair down. The product’s moisturizing properties also help combat dryness, a common issue for curly hair.
- Type 4 Hair (Coily): This encompasses coily hair, often described as having tight coils or zig-zag patterns. Kinky Curly Curling Custard can be effective on this hair type, especially when used in conjunction with other moisturizing products. It can help to define coils, reduce shrinkage, and add shine. However, thicker Type 4 hair may require more product and layering techniques to achieve desired results.
Potential Drawbacks and Limitations
While Kinky Curly Curling Custard is a popular choice, it’s essential to recognize its limitations for certain hair types and conditions.
- Fine Hair: Those with fine hair may find the custard too heavy, leading to a weighed-down, less voluminous look. It might be necessary to use a smaller amount or dilute the product with water to achieve the desired results.
- Low Porosity Hair: Low porosity hair struggles to absorb moisture, so the custard’s moisturizing benefits might not fully penetrate the hair shaft. Pre-pooing with oils or using a leave-in conditioner before applying the custard can help improve absorption.
- Extremely Dry or Damaged Hair: While the custard provides moisture, it might not be enough for severely dry or damaged hair. In these cases, it’s best to incorporate richer moisturizing treatments and oils into the hair care routine.
Styling Techniques for Different Curl Patterns
The application of Kinky Curly Curling Custard can be tailored to various curl patterns to maximize its benefits.
- Type 3A-3B (Loose Curls): Apply the custard to soaking wet hair, section by section. Rake the product through each section, and then gently scrunch the hair upwards to encourage curl formation. Air drying or diffusing can be used for optimal results.
- Type 3C-4A (Tight Curls): Use the “shingling” method, where each individual curl is coated with the custard to define and separate the curls. This method works well to elongate the curls and minimize frizz.
- Type 4B-4C (Coils/Zig-Zags): Apply the custard to freshly washed and conditioned hair. Use the “prayer hands” method (smoothing the product down the hair shafts with palms facing each other) or finger coil individual sections for added definition.

Amount of Product Needed Based on Hair Length and Density
The amount of Kinky Curly Curling Custard needed varies depending on your hair’s length and density. Fine hair typically requires less product than thick, coarse hair. Knowing how much to use helps prevent product buildup and ensures optimal curl definition.
The following are general guidelines, remember that these are estimations, and you may need to adjust the amounts based on your hair’s specific needs.
* Fine, Short Hair (Chin-Length or Shorter): Start with a pea-sized amount per section. This is to avoid weighing down the hair.
Fine, Long Hair (Past Shoulders)
Begin with a dime-sized amount per section. You may need more depending on the hair’s density and how quickly it absorbs the product.
Thick, Short Hair
A dime-sized amount per section is a good starting point. Adjust as needed.
Thick, Long Hair
Start with a quarter-sized amount per section, adjusting as needed. This hair type often needs more product to achieve full definition.
Remember that it’s always better to start with less and add more if needed. It’s easier to add product than to remove it.
Best Methods for Applying the Custard
To avoid product buildup and achieve optimal results, consider the following application methods:
- Raking: Run your fingers through your hair, distributing the product evenly. This method is suitable for looser curl patterns.
- Smoothing: Smooth the product down each section of hair, ensuring all strands are coated. This helps to define the curls and reduce frizz.
- Praying Hands Method: Apply the product to your hair, and then smooth your hair between your palms as if in prayer. This is great for creating sleek curls.
- Shingling: Carefully separate each curl and coat it with the custard. This technique provides maximum definition, perfect for tighter curl patterns.
The key is to ensure even distribution. Avoid applying the product directly to the scalp, which can lead to buildup.

Maximizing Effectiveness
To get the most out of Kinky Curly Curling Custard, preparation is key. Begin with clean, well-conditioned hair. Applying the product to soaking wet hair is crucial for optimal curl definition and hydration. This helps the custard evenly distribute and lock in moisture. Section your hair and apply the custard generously, using your fingers to smooth and define each curl.
For maximum volume, flip your head over and gently scrunch your hair upwards. Allow your hair to air dry or use a diffuser on a low heat setting.
Combining with Other Products
Kinky Curly Curling Custard can be a team player. To create a customized hair care routine, consider layering it with other products. A leave-in conditioner before the custard adds an extra layer of moisture, particularly beneficial for drier hair types. A gel, applied after the custard, can provide additional hold and definition. Experiment to discover what works best for your hair.
Maintaining Curls and Preventing Frizz
Throughout the day, it’s essential to protect your curls from frizz. Avoid excessive touching of your hair, as this can disrupt the curl pattern and introduce frizz. If you need to refresh your curls, lightly mist your hair with water and reapply a small amount of the custard, gently scrunching the curls back into shape. Carry a small spray bottle filled with water and a travel-sized Kinky Curly Curling Custard for quick touch-ups on the go.
Overnight Curl Preservation
Protecting your curls overnight is crucial for maintaining their definition and reducing frizz. The following best practices can help preserve your curls:
- Silk or Satin Pillowcases: These pillowcases create less friction than cotton, reducing breakage and frizz. They allow your hair to glide smoothly across the surface, preserving your curl pattern.
- Protective Styles: Consider protective styles such as pineappleing your hair (gathering your hair loosely on top of your head) or using a satin bonnet or scarf. These options minimize friction and prevent your curls from getting flattened while you sleep.
- Loose Braids or Twists: For a more defined curl pattern the next morning, gently braid or twist your hair before bed. This will help maintain the curl shape and add a little extra definition.
- Avoid Tight Styles: Avoid pulling your hair back too tightly, as this can cause breakage and flatten your curls. Opt for loose styles that allow your hair to move freely.

Flaking and White Residue
Flaking or the appearance of white residue is a common complaint. This usually happens when too much product is applied, or when the hair isn’t fully saturated with water during application.
- Excess Product: Applying too much Curling Custard can lead to buildup, resulting in flakes as the product dries. It’s crucial to start with a small amount and add more only if needed.
- Product Incompatibility: Sometimes, the Curling Custard doesn’t play well with other products. Using it with a leave-in conditioner that’s too heavy or contains incompatible ingredients can contribute to flaking.
- Incomplete Absorption: If the hair isn’t sufficiently wet when applying the custard, it might not distribute evenly, leading to residue.
Stiffness and Crunchy Curls
Nobody wants stiff, crunchy curls. This often results from using too much product, or a lack of moisture.
- Over-Application: Similar to flaking, applying too much product can make curls stiff. The custard needs to be used sparingly, especially on finer hair types.
- Lack of Moisture: If the hair is dry before applying the custard, it will absorb the product unevenly, leading to stiffness. Ensuring the hair is well-hydrated is crucial.
- Hard Water: Hard water can leave mineral deposits on the hair, contributing to a crunchy feel.
Lack of Definition and Clumping
Sometimes, curls don’t clump or define as desired. This could be due to incorrect application or product compatibility.
- Uneven Distribution: If the product isn’t distributed evenly throughout the hair, some sections might not curl properly, leading to a lack of definition.
- Product Buildup: Buildup from other products or hard water can prevent the custard from effectively defining the curls.
- Incompatible Products: Using the custard with products that contain silicones or other ingredients that create a barrier can hinder curl definition.
